Skip to content

Latest commit

 

History

History
27 lines (22 loc) · 689 Bytes

README.md

File metadata and controls

27 lines (22 loc) · 689 Bytes

Compiling

  • Place NRF5 SDK 12.1 next to this directory (../nRF5_SDK_12.1.0_0d23e2a/)
  • Set compiler path in ../nRF5_SDK_12.1.0_0d23e2a/components/toolchain/gcc/Makefile.posix
  • Install python 2.7 and pip install nrfutil (and maybe add ~/.local/bin to $PATH)
  • Install make
  • Install gcc-arm-none-eabi
  • Execute make

BLE firmware update

  1. Install NRF Connect
  2. Connect DFU boot pins
  3. Connect to DFUTARG
  4. Select DFU

Boot pin configuration

  1. BLE DFU mode DFU
  2. RC mode RC

Debug pins (SWD)

SWD

Pictures

Fagus Unimog

Board